The learning curve for new users adopting Session AI is generally moderate, with a mix of quick wins early on and more advanced complexity as a team goes deeper into optimization with real-time decisioning. The learning curve for new users is easy to start with in the initial phase because Session AI is relatively approachable at the beginning. The basic dashboard and insights are easy to understand, and pre-built use cases help the team get started quickly. Users can see value early through simple campaigns or triggers, allowing most users to become productive within a short period without deep technical knowledge. There is moderate complexity at the setup and configuration phase. The learning curve becomes steeper when moving into configuration and customization. Setting up real-time rules and triggers requires some understanding of user behavior strategies. Integration with existing systems may also need coordination with technical teams, and defining the right segmentation logic takes some experimentation. This is where most users, including my team and I, need guidance, documentation, and support. In terms of advanced usage, the most challenging part is mastering optimization and scaling because fine-tuning AI-driven actions for maximum conversion impact is crucial, and managing multiple overlapping campaigns or strategies is necessary. Experience plays a big role here, and the team typically improves over time through iteration. I would rate this product a 9 out of 10 based on my overall experience.
